Spatially averaged reverberation time (Receivers + grid)

This menu command offers to display diagrams and tables showing the averaged reverberation times T30, T20, T10 and EDT for all receivers (see Receiver) above frequency. The evaluation of the spatially averaged reverberation time just occurs for the currently used variant (see Variants).
For this, the particle model („Particles“ or „Image Sources --> Particles“, see Configuration). In addition, the option „Calculate Echograms and Decay Curves ... for Receivers“ on the „RIA-evaluation“ tab has to be activated (see "RIR-Evaluation" tab).
Diagrams and Tables
The following diagrams and tables can be displayed:
- diagram and table for receivers: The displayed reverberation time curves are determined from the echograms at all receivers.
- diagram for grid: The displayed reverberation time curves are determined from the echograms at all grid points.
- table for receivers: The reverberation times incl. standard deviation are determined from the echograms at the points of all receivers.
- table for receiver chains: These reverberation times are determined from the echograms at the points of all receiver chains
- table for receivers (variant comparison): The reverberation times incl. standard deviation are determined from the echograms of all active receivers for each variant in use.
- table for receiver chains (variant comparison): These reverberation times are determined from the echograms at the points of all active receiver chains for all variants in use.

Variant Comparison
This option is deactivated by default ("off"). If more than one variant (see Variants) is used, it is possible to switch between the results of the active variants after calculation and display the corresponding reverberation time curves (or "all").
User defined room volume
Some requirements for the reverberation time depend on the room volume. To be able to show these requirements in the reverberation time dialog, the user-defined room volume must be activated. The numerical preset value corresponds to the room volume, which is calculated from dimensions in Room/Room Parameters (see Room).
Note
If the effective volume differs from this volume (e.g. because box-type obstacles have been used to model other, non-rectangular rooms) this option allows to enter the room volume (in m³) to be used to calculate the requirements e.g. accord. to DIN 18041.
User defined reverberation times
In this dialog it is possible to define up to two reverence curves (e.g. from measurements) of the reverberation time, which can be displayed in the reverberation time diagram. The target reverberation time used for calibrating spectra can also be displayed in as a third curve (see Calibrate Spectra). The maximum value of the display range can be set as well.

Dialog user defined reverence reverberation times
The values for the two user defined reference reverberation times are saved as textblocks in the respective local library.
